Metal vs. Shingle: Roofing Material Comparison for Local Homes
Energy Efficiency
The energy efficiency of a roofing material can significantly influence heating and cooling costs for homes. Metal roofs tend to reflect sunlight, which helps keep homes cooler in warmer months. This reflective property can reduce the need for air conditioning, leading to lower energy bills. In contrast, asphalt shingles absorb heat, potentially raising indoor temperatures and increasing reliance on cooling systems.
Additionally, the insulation properties of the roofing material play a crucial role in overall energy efficiency. Metal roofs can provide better insulation when paired with appropriate underlayment, contributing to decreased energy consumption throughout the year. Shingle roofs offer a different advantage, with the ability to create a more traditional appearance while still providing adequate thermal performance. Homeowners may want to consider not only initial costs but also potential savings on energy bills when selecting the appropriate roofing material.

Environmental Impact
Both metal and shingle roofing materials have distinct environmental footprints that impact their overall sustainability. Metal roofs, often made from recycled materials, contribute positively to environmental health. They are typically fully recyclable at the end of their lifespan, reducing landfill waste. In contrast, shingle roofs are commonly composed of asphalt, which may typically not contain recycled content and can create significant waste when replaced. The production process for shingles also demands substantial energy resources and often uses non-renewable materials, making their environmental impact heavier.

Sustainability and Recycling Considerations
Metal roofing has garnered attention in recent years for its sustainability. Made primarily from recycled materials, metal roofs can often be fully recycled at the end of their life cycle, reducing the burden on landfills. Their durability also means they can last significantly longer than traditional shingle roofs, sometimes exceeding 50 years. This longevity contributes to less frequent replacements, leading to reduced resource consumption over time.
Shingle roofing, while widely used, presents its own challenges in terms of sustainability. Many asphalt shingles are not recyclable and can contribute to substantial waste when replaced. However, advancements in shingle manufacturing are working toward more eco-friendly options, incorporating recycled materials and establishing programs for proper disposal and recycling. Homeowners should weigh these considerations, especially if environmental impact is a key factor in their roofing choice.
Maintenance Requirements
Metal roofing typically requires less maintenance over its lifespan compared to shingle roofs. The durable nature of metal helps it resist damage from weather elements, pests, and mold. Periodic inspections are recommended to check for any loose seams or fasteners. Regular cleaning, especially in areas with heavy foliage, ensures that debris does not accumulate and create potential drainage issues.
Shingle roofs, on the other hand, demand more frequent upkeep. Individual shingles can crack or become dislodged due to age or extreme weather. Maintaining proper ventilation within the attic is also essential to prevent moisture buildup, which can lead to mold growth or further roof deterioration. Homeowners should keep an eye on granule loss, as this can indicate wear and signal the need for replacement.

Noise Factor
Choosing between metal and shingle roofing can significantly impact the noise levels within a home. Metal roofs tend to amplify sounds, such as rain or hail, which can result in a more pronounced auditory experience during inclement weather. Although modern metal roofing systems incorporate insulation materials, the inherent reflective properties of metal can make homes feel louder when weather events occur.
In contrast, shingle roofs provide a quieter atmosphere indoors. The asphalt material absorbs sound, helping to dampen any external noise, which can create a more serene living environment. Homeowners seeking peace and tranquility may find shingles more appealing, especially in areas prone to severe weather. Ultimately, the noise factor plays a crucial role in selecting the right roofing material for comfort and livability.
